Epson iPrint is the perfect accessory for your Epson wireless printer. With the free app you can easily print your documents and pictures from your Android smartphone via the home network. You can even scan with the remote solution – but here, unlike the print function, not all devices are supported. Whether the free app can really compete with a PC solution, the test shows. If you’re using an Epson wireless printer, “Epson iPrint” is definitely a must. Printing is not more convenient from a smartphone or tablet. Also, the integration of cloud storage is successful and certainly forward-looking – so you can print all documents from anywhere, without first copying the files back and forth. The overall impression is clouded only by the partially poor print quality. Here you have to readjust a lot – and who has very high standards, that will not be enough. You also need to spend more time with Word documents. If you own a printer from another brand, you will also find your own app in the Google Play Store, such as “HP ePrint Home & Biz”. Already at the start, the app browses your home Wi-Fi network for available printers and connects to them even before you know it. All you have to do is select your desired document and send the print command. The delay until the start of printing is extremely short – this is not faster even with a USB connection. Even from the far corner of the house, the print jobs in the test were always processed quickly and reliably. If you’ve already switched to cloud storage, “Epson iPrint” does it twice: You do not need to download your documents first and then save them on your mobile phone. The app can directly access known providers such as Dropbox or Google Drive and print files stored there. This worked flawlessly in the test with documents from the “Dropbox”. So that you are not surprised by an empty printer cartridge, the app can even read the status of your printer. This will give you information about the level of the cartridges at any time or if there is a fault on the device. The default settings of the Android app provide a very moderate print quality – this is hardly noticeable on typed documents, but already a logo appears blurred and pixelated. Here you have to change some print settings to achieve a satisfactory quality – unfortunately the possibilities are also limited. If you have a Word document, the app can not do anything with it at first. If you still want to print it, “Epson iPrint” first converts it to a PDF file.
